Interrogation Site Metadata
WW2 - SF Walla Walla at Bear Creek
Status: DecommissionedGeneral Operational Period: Year Round
Start Date: 10/16/2002 2:40 PM
End Date: 8/6/2019 12:00 AM
The WW2 PIT interrogation site is located on the South Fork Walla Walla River approximately 21 kilometers upstream from the confluence with the North Fork Walla Walla River. The site consists of two pass over HDPE antennas that overlap to cover the full wetted width of the river immediately upstream from the Bear Creek confluence. A IS1001 Master Controller and two IS1001 nodes are powered by a thermoelectric generator. Site is no longer active.

1/1/2021 2:23:00 PM | General | Due to a flooding event that occurred in early February 2020, transceiver and other equipment were washed away and never recovered. There are no current plans to reestablish this site. All available data are uploaded unless a transceiver is recovered and more data can be extracted. |
